Die Feder ist zu diesem Zweck als Aufsteckhülse ausgebildet, die je nach dem Durchmesser des Bohrerschaftes und der Spindelbohrung einzelnThere are already chucks known in which the clamping of the drill with the help of a in the chuck arranged coil spring is effected, which, expanded by the drill pressure, rests firmly against the wall of the chuck sleeve. Such a coil spring should According to the present invention are used to drill bits and other tools, namely those in which the usual driver tab has broken off in the conical cavity of a to clamp the ordinary drill spindle. For this purpose, the spring is used as a push-on sleeve formed individually depending on the diameter of the drill shank and the spindle bore

J 5 or several times placed on the drill shaft and pushed into the spindle together with it. A flat driver tongue K attached to the upper end of the sleeve serves on the one hand to drive out the drill and the spring sleeve by means of a wedge and, on the other hand, to initially widen the spring sleeve a little when the drill is not yet firmly pressed in and thereby lay it against the inner wall of the spindle bore. The working pressure of the drill then automatically clamps the tool without any further stress on the driver tab.

Auf beiliegender Zeichnung zeigt Fig. 1 die aus Draht gewundene Federhülse, Fig. 2 im Schnitt die Art der Befestigung eines Bohrers mit abgebrochenem Schaft in der Bohrspindel.In the accompanying drawing, Fig. 1 shows the spring sleeve wound from wire, Fig. 2 in the Cut the type of attachment of a drill with a broken shaft in the drill spindle.
